👇AI + IoT =😱 ✔️Definition: AIoT combines Artificial Intelligence (AI) with the Internet of Things (IoT), integrating AI technologies into IoT infrastructure to create intelligent, connected devices and systems ✔️Enhanced capabilities: AIoT enables devices to not only collect and share data but also analyze it, learn from it, and make autonomous decisions without human intervention. This allows for more efficient data processing and decision-making at the edge. ✔️Wide range of applications: AIoT is being applied across various industries, including retail, agriculture, healthcare, manufacturing, and smart cities. Some examples include smart cameras for security, intelligent shopping carts, automated vehicles, and traffic monitoring systems. ✔️Edge intelligence: AIoT facilitates edge computing by moving AI capabilities closer to the data source, reducing the need for cloud analytics and improving response times. This is particularly useful in applications requiring real-time decision-making. Benefits: AIoT offers numerous advantages, including improved operational efficiency, predictive maintenance, personalized customer experiences, and the ability to address workforce shortages. IoT is entering a new phase: what used to differentiate products is now the minimum requirement. Here's what stood out to us at Embedded World 2026: 1. Edge AI is becoming an expectation Edge AI is no longer experimental; it’s becoming standard. But once devices hit the field, reality kicks in. Data changes, environments differ, and models need to evolve. Deployment isn’t the finish line anymore. As Robin Maristad Saltnes from @nordicsemi pointed out, moving intelligence onto the device brings clear benefits - faster response, more privacy, less reliance on the cloud. But it also raises a new challenge: making these models accessible and usable for embedded teams. And as Dimitar Tomov from Thistle Technologies highlighted, models don’t stay “correct” forever. They need to be updated in the field - securely, over-the-air, and without heavy firmware overhead. 2. Connectivity is becoming invisible Not a feature - a baseline. Devices are expected to stay connected globally, without manual intervention or complex setup. As Giulia Manzini from @onomondo noted, technologies like NTN and evolving standards such as SGP.32 are pushing the industry toward truly seamless global coverage. 3. Integration is still the bottleneck Hardware. Firmware. Connectivity. Cloud. Bringing everything together is still where most projects slow down. As Maria Hernandez from Qoitech put it, teams today are no longer deep specialists in just one layer - they’re system integrators. Which makes access to the right data, tools, and insights across the full stack critical. And from the security side, as Omar Cruz from Infineon Technologies emphasized, moving AI to the edge only works if it’s both secure and simple to deploy - across hardware, software, and the full development flow. Still a lot of moving parts in most IoT projects.
